Question
The angles of a triangle are in the ratio 3 :2 : 7. Find each angle.

Solution
Ratio in angles of a triangle = 3:2:7
Sum of ratios = 3 + 2 + 7=12
Sum of angles of a triangle = 180°
∴ First angle = `3/12 xx 180° = 45°`
Second angle = `2/12` x 180°= 30°
Third angle =`7/12` x 180°= 105°
